        No, your real problem is that your code is just wrong.
        @
        // example taken from the QSqlDatabase documentation

        QSqlDatabase db = QSqlDatabase::addDatabase("QPSQL");
        db.setHostName("acidalia");
        ...

        // your code

        QSqlDatabase db;
        db.addDatabase("QSQLITE");
        db.setDatabaseName("GestionVinoteca");
        ...
        @

                                    Hey, temper temper. You might have something wrong with your env variables when you run from QtCreator. You said that you have copied qsqllite4.dll into the folder of your app, but this won't help. When deploying you must make a subdir called "sqldrivers" there you have to copy qsqllite4.dll if you run the release version or qsqllite4d.dll if you run the debug version. To be sure just copy both.
                                    Another thing if you have those two dlls then you definetly have sqllite support. The SDK version has it. If nothing works try uninstalling all and reinstall it again. However when I have compiled Qt as static from the vanilla sources I didn't have any problem in using qsqllite(do not use: -no-sql-sqlite and or -system-sqlite).
